Abstract

A cutting and containing device for highly vertical polyester-viscose linen-like elastic fabric belongs to the technical field of cutting devices, wherein a fixed groove is formed in the upper wall surface of a cutting machine, a stretching device for clamping fabric is fixedly installed in the fixed groove, a pressing roller for ironing the fabric is installed at the rear end of the inside of the fixed groove, a waste material groove for collecting the fabric at the corner is formed in the upper wall surface of the cutting machine, a winding roller capable of winding the fabric is arranged in the waste material groove, connecting columns are fixedly installed at the two ends of the winding roller, a rotating piece is arranged on the connecting columns, and a device groove is formed in the left wall surface of the cutting machine. Highly vertical cutting and containing equipment for polyester viscose linen-like elastic fabric
Technical Field
The invention belongs to the technical field of cutting equipment, and particularly relates to cutting and containing equipment for a highly vertical polyester-viscose linen-like elastic fabric.

The principle of the invention is as follows: when cutting cloth, a worker puts the cloth on the movable blocks 8, the clamping plate 11 is pressed downwards to clamp the cloth by screwing the bolts 12, when the cloth moves slowly, the movable blocks 8 slide on the cloth plate 6, the distance between the two movable blocks 8 gradually becomes far, the cut cloth is pulled towards two sides while being tightened, the subsequent cloth is conveniently cut by the cutting knife 3 to avoid the problems of dislocation and untidy fold cutting of the cloth, when the cutting knife 3 cuts the cloth, the elastic cloth is pulled by the movable blocks 8 to facilitate the cutting knife 3 to cut, the problems of secondary trimming, the cut cloth passes through the compression roller 13, the compression roller 13 flattens the cloth, the compression roller 13 driven by an external motor drives the cloth to move continuously, and the movable blocks 8 are driven to slide in the cloth plate 6 when the cloth moves, the sliding movable block 8 stretches the spring to the maximum length, then pulls back the movable block 8 under the action of the elastic force of the spring, then circularly stretches and cuts, and the cut cloth is ironed by the press roller 13 and simultaneously wound by the winding roller 34 through the placing plate 41.
The winding roller 34 is rotated by the connecting piece 21 and the rotating piece 33 driven by the driving plate 19, the worker swings the movable plate 27 through the handle slot 30, the second spring 20 is compressed by the pressing block 28 when the movable plate 27 swings back and forth, meanwhile, the second spring 20 rebounds to bounce the extrusion block 28, so that the movable plate 27 continuously swings, the swinging movable plate 27 extrudes the two connecting pieces 21 through the limiting blocks 31 to ascend, the connecting pieces 21 drive the pushing plate 35 to move upwards, the driving plate 35 which moves upwards rotates the rotating block 38 through the connecting shaft 37, the wind-up roll 34 is rotated to wind up the cloth under the cooperation of the movable plate 27, the connecting piece 21 and the rotating piece 33, when the cloth is rolled, the rolling roller 34 is not rotated any more as long as the movable plate 27 is stopped, the rolled rolling roller 34 is taken out, and a new rolling roller 34 is replaced, so that the effect of convenient storage after the cloth is cut is achieved.
